BAE, US Navy Scuttle $4.6M Propeller Damage Suit
At the request of the parties, a Florida federal judge on Tuesday dismissed a $4.6 million suit filed by a BAE Systems PLC-owned contractor against the U.S. Department of the Navy alleging it didn't owe damages for supposedly performing negligent and defective work on a ship’s propeller.
